DEX+2, STA+2 (6 weeks: A, 5 weeks: B, 4-C, 3-D, 2-F) Beets. I will focus on my diet to make sure I'm properly fueled and taking care of myself. My problem isn’t so much the usual meals (though we sometimes go out to a restaurant more than once a week), but the snacks or desserts around the house. I will score my diet as follows, though it is partially subjective.1 point: Each “healthy†meal, with the goal of keeping things as natural and unprocessed as possible, up to three meals per day. Can’t go the full nine yards of paleo or completely unprocessed due to needing carbs for energy for the running, but I will make the judgment call for each situation.-0.5 point: Each snack (non-healthy ones) or dessert. 0 points (no change): Unhealthy meals or meals with lots of processed food. Don’t want to train myself through punishment to starve rather than eat something mediocre, but don’t want to reward the habit either.0 points (no change): Energy gels, bars, or sports drinks ONLY the morning of or during runs over 10 miles. Any situation other than before/during a 10+ mile run will be considered a snack. Maximum score over the challenge is 126 points, graded as follows: A: 100+ points, B: 90+, C: 80+, D: 70+) CON+2, CHA+2 Battlestar Galactica. UH60guy Posted July 26, 2013 Author Report Share Posted July 26, 2013 Gonna hit the gym in about 30 minutes on the first test workout of my BSG theme in preparation for the challenge starting next week: Episode Inspiration: 33 (ep 1.01)Theme: The fleet is fatigued after attacks from Cylons every 33 minutes.Intensity: Medium weight. For each exercise, do 3 sets of 8 reps, one set of 9 (33 reps total). 33 seconds rest between sets.Exercise 1: Pull ups (assisted as needed to reach reps)Exercise 2: Box jumpsExercise 3: Two-handed kettlebell swingExercise 4: Push ups (vary style/intensity to match ability, such as decline or side to side)Exercise 5: Mountain climbers I've been populating a big Excel sheet with similar info as above, and some randomize functions. I ran down the list of the first two seasons' episodes and it is set up to randomly pick one of these each time I want to go to the gym. So far most of the exercises tied to each episode are also randomly selected- over the weekend though I'll see if I can make a few of them fit the episode better Of course, once I get a finished Excel sheet ready I'll post it here in case anyone else wants to try as well, or even adapt it to make it their own. UH60guy Posted July 26, 2013 Author Report Share Posted July 26, 2013 Well, lesson learned- in a good way. By having that "theme" category in there it let me make adjustments as needed. Like halfway through the box jump I found it was too easy- was able to switch to 3 sets of 33, with 33 seconds rest because I knew my underlying theme to the random workout, not just "go do this." Same with the KB swing- only a 20 lb KB was available, so again, 3 sets of 33. Mountain climbers OK as written, but I do four count exercises there (left-right-left-one, left-right-left-two), and I feel I can crank out regular pushups all day (my records: 76 in one set, 100 in two), so I did the side to side pushups from the Batman Bodyweight Routine as those are pretty challenging for me.
